Optimizing the Allocation of Water Resources and Consumption in the Philippines Using Linear Programming
摘要
Water scarcity is a pressing issue that is exacerbated by population growth, urbanization, and climate change. To address this, sustainable and effective water management must be practiced. In this study, linear programming was used to determine the optimal allocation of the forecasted 2023 water supply in the Philippines. The objective function and constraints were set using data from the Philippine Statistics Authority. Results indicate that the minimum expenses on water for the year 2023 amounted to PHP 129,440,000,000. The energy sector had the highest share in total water use under the optimal solution. On the other hand, households had the lowest share among the six sectors. The researchers suggest that future studies incorporate more constraints related to the costs or profit from water usage per sector to improve the linear programming model. Moreover, future researchers may explore alternative methods outside of MATLAB, such as those that use simplex tableaus.
